Перейти к содержанию
    

А вот какой мелкий контроллер использовать?

3 минуты назад, mantech сказал:

Вот для примера силовой расширитель моей "бензоколонки"

Красулька плата)))

1 минуту назад, my504 сказал:

а МК в балансире. Это перебор.

А теперь вспоминаем "адук". Там, правда, МК в АЦП. Тоже рискованное решение.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

3 минуты назад, my504 сказал:

А тут очень узкая ниша. Практически точечная. Скорее не балансир в МК, а МК в балансире. Это перебор.

Да, узкая, согласен, хотя полно мс, те же BQ серии, которые и балансир и мк в одном корпусе, ничего плохого в этом нет, но такую позицию я обязательно бы держал на складе в нужных кол-вах, ИМХО.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

2 minutes ago, AlexandrY said:

если у вас нет планов расти, то да можно юзать всю жизнь пики. 

Вы видимо спутали собеседника...

Вообще то под "пиками" понимаются не только 8-битники. Я работаю и с STM32, и с dsPIC33. И у меня нет никакого желания переходит только на АРМ. Значительная часть моих задач на АРМах решается с большим геморроем и завышенными ресурсами.

Более того, я отказался от STM32F051 в пользу PIC18F27Q43 просто потому, что первый не реализует часть функционала изделия ПО ОПРЕДЕЛЕНИЮ. Бедная периферия для этих задач.

Но есть и прямо противоположные примеры замены dsPIC33EP на самый дешевый STM32F030F4.

3 minutes ago, MrBearManul said:

Там, правда, МК в АЦП. Тоже рискованное решение.

АЦП не имеет узко заточенного применения. Поэтому ваш пример неудачен.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

16 минут назад, my504 сказал:

Если вам ОДНОВРЕМЕННО нужно всё

Повторю, так говорит их реклама, а на деле использовать сразу всё невозможно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Just now, Plain said:

на деле использовать сразу всё невозможно.

Вообще то это ОЧЕВИДНО. Из каких соображений вы решили, что в маловыводных МК можно использовать всю периферию? Это типовое ограничение у ВСЕХ производителей.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

8 минут назад, my504 сказал:

АЦП не имеет узко заточенного применения. Поэтому ваш пример неудачен.

Снова не удачен? Может быть вы снова поглядите даташит более внимательно?))) Там на одном таком "адуке" делали целые приборы с интерфейсом пользователя. Конецно, можно взять отдельные АЦП и 51-й МК) Но тогда да, делать зарядник на рассыпухе вполне логично) Вся соль-то как раз в том, что мы используем "супернавороченную" микросхему, которая даёт нам всё для построения законченного модуля, а то и прибора. И да, можно сделать из отдельных частей, но тогда мы теряем в габаритах, в сложности изготовления и т.п. и т.п. и т.д. и т.д.

6 минут назад, Plain сказал:

Повторю, так говорит их реклама, а на деле использовать сразу всё невозможно.

Реклама она такая) Всегда показывает продукт с выгодной стороны в условиях фантастичного и неудобного применения.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

4 minutes ago, MrBearManul said:

Там на одном таком "адуке" делали целые приборы с интерфейсом пользователя.

Вы оцениваете риски не с той стороны. Риски определяются с позиции ПРОИЗВОДИТЕЛЯ. Это он решает когда снять с производства.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

1 минуту назад, my504 сказал:

Вы оцениваете риски не с то

Что вы имеете в виду?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

4 minutes ago, MrBearManul said:

Что вы имеете в виду?

Случайно отправил раньше времени, извините. Выше дописал.

Производитель легко найдет сбыт для АЦП, потому что рынок очень широкий. А вот балансир для лития - это очень узко.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

3 минуты назад, my504 сказал:

Вы оцениваете риски не с той стороны. Риски определяются с позиции ПРОИЗВОДИТЕЛЯ. Это он решает когда снять с производства.

Согласен) Вообще тема уже медленно и верно скатывается то ли во флуд, то ли в обсуждение наболевших вопросов))) Тем не менее, считаю, что она очень полезная, т.к. конкретно от вас узнал про конкретные серии пиков, на которые бегло глянул) Довольно интересные микроконтроллеры. А можно вопрос? Они же повзоляют внутрисхемную отладку, ни типа как через JTAG/SWD кортексы?)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

10 minutes ago, MrBearManul said:

Они же повзоляют внутрисхемную отладку, ни типа как через JTAG/SWD кортексы?)

Младшие (восьмибитники) - не имеют JTAG. dsPIC-и частично (у многих в эррате есть исключение). PIC32 - позволяют все.

Но я не использую JTAG в пиках. У меня есть PICkit4 (аж две штуки для параллельного дебага ядер в dsPIC33CH) и ICD3. Хватает для вполне комфортной работы с дебагом через ICSP. Этот интерфейс для дебага есть почти во всех восьмибитниках и всех остальных МК Микрочипа

Правда, порой не хватает сканирования данных при исполнении кода (ICSP это не позволяет, в отличии от JTAG), но нахожу иные решения - всегда есть интерфейс вывода.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

18 часов назад, adnega сказал:

сейчас разрабатываю управление автофорсункой чисто на МК (STM32F3). С поцикловым ограничением тока, с форсированием и удерживанием, с накачкой высоковольтной емкости, расширенной диагностикой и т.п

Что-то типа MC33816 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

https://hackaday.com/2021/01/18/pandemic-chip-shortages-are-shutting-down-automotive-production/

Цены на МК идут вверх. Но у ST (STM8 и STM32) сильнее всего подорожание по слухам будет.

Всю тему перечитать не осилил, но подозреваю, что как обычно каждый "тянет одеяло на себя". Потяну немного и на себя, выскажусь. Извините если что-то уже было сказано, нет времени всю тему перечитать.

Имхо STM8 брать имеет смысл, когда нужна мощь его периферии. А в нынешних условиях несколько рискованно столкнуться с обломом с доставаемостью или повышением цены. Имхо если был опыт с PICами и нужен примитивный девайс - ну почему бы и нет? Старье или нет, выпускаться будут еще долго, стабильно. А в более сложном девайсе перейти на другую линейку не особо проблема, тут то и привыкать не к чему будет. Клон PICKIT 3 стоит ~$11, не отличимый от оригинала. Оригинал MPLAB Snap можно за $15-20 купить. Бесплатный XC8 оптимизирует более-менее, для простейших задач будет пофиг. На Си вполне себе пишется сейчас для пиков. Ну а еще они нынче стремятся унифицировать среду и компилятор для AVR и PICов, причем всех, включая 32-битные.

Ну и еще есть интересный блог с детальными обзорами и сравнением МК до $1: https://jaycarlson.net/microcontrollers/ Если с английским в ладах более-менее - там очень хорошо всё расписано. Включая доступность и удобство средств разработки.

А еще есть копеечные 3-центовые МК китайские: https://cpldcpu.wordpress.com/2019/08/12/the-terrible-3-cent-mcu/

Но там конечно дичь со средствами разработки и программатором. Хотя OpenSource вариант программера под Padauk уже где-то был на гитхабе давно, а SDCC вроде как поддерживает их тоже.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

1 hour ago, mantech said:

Вот для примера силовой расширитель моей "бензоколонки", все на одном чипе - ненавистной аврке, больше ничего нет, никакой экзотики и кучи МС, плата управляет движком, кучей АС и DC каналов, и датчиков...

pwr.jpg

Это во-первых не силовая плата.
Она не конвертирует энергию, а только коммутирует, причем сигналы достаточно низкомощные и медленные. 
Во-вторых, извините, но от таких  разъемов мы отказались много лет назад. Эт не разъемы, а кошмар инсталлятора. 
Вытащить такой зимой - настоящее испытание нервов. Прямое следствие бездумного удешевления и игнорирования юзабельности.
Короче низкий уровень и не показатель ничего. 
 
Вот как выглядит подобное изделие у меня:
   image.png.fe86d435c8026c1623cdc72fbbf7fbde.png

Индикация не только на дискретных выходах, но на всех сигналах, благодаря дополнительной микросхеме расширителя I/O 
Помимо JTAG/SWD с трассировкой есть для всесторонней  диагностики USB 2.0 HS интерфейс через который осциллографируется любой сигнал в программе!
Есть беспроводной интерфейс.
CAN гальваноизолированный. Нет навесных транзисторов, плата технологичней в изготовлении. 
И сделана на двух микроконтроллерах общего применения:
image.png.bde43e1efb5a67129cf82a6c09bc2eec.png
Вот такая классика жанра. 

Сейчас я бы туда поставил модуль на RP2040

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

5 часов назад, ViKo сказал:

Документация не внушает доверия, и с доступом к ней были сложности. 

Это чем же??? :shok: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...